Output 265437508405223c009e9f58227997b086e0f661a839d2921a5ae88cb2527cd5:6

value
166400000
script pubkey
OP_0 OP_PUSHBYTES_20 665fa1af428a308d3abe0e3e197a04ac8d817509
address
ltc1qve06rt6z3gcg6w47pclpj7sy4jxczagf96umys
transaction
265437508405223c009e9f58227997b086e0f661a839d2921a5ae88cb2527cd5
spent
true